Matlab trading toolbox. The toolbox includes functions for analyzing transaction costs, accessing trade and quote pricing data, defining order types, and executing orders. The toolbox lets you integrate streaming and event-based data into MATLAB®, enabling you to develop financial trading strategies and algorithms that analyze and react to the market in real time. The Trading Toolbox in MATLAB provides capabilities for analyzing trading strategies, accessing financial data, and working with live trading platforms. Get started with Trading Toolbox by learning how to connect to interactive brokers, specify contracts and orders and submit trades. Supported data providers include Bloomberg ®, FRED ®, Haver Analytics ®, Quandl ®, and Refinitiv™. .
